The Open Space Division and the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service, in partnership, bring birdwatching to your local library! During this adult program participants will learn how to identify common species and the best locations around the city to spot our feathered friends! Not only will you get the chance to practice binocular and field guide use in the classroom, but an optional guided walk around the urban space outside of the library will be offered at the end of the program to practice those skills.
